Book excerpt: Excerpt from British Letters, Illustrative of Character and Social Life The aim Of this work is to present certain phases of life and Character as described and exemplified by British letter-writers. While the search for materials has not been exhaust tive, it has been reasonably thorough. The number Of writers quoted is not particularly large; and that fact is a matter of indifference; for the end in view has not been to crowd the pages with distinguished names, but to insure the essential fitness Of the selections - a fitness consisting in their special adaptation to the plan Of the series. The peculiar Charm Of letters - perhaps, also, their greatest value - is brought home to us when they are familiar, unstudied expressions Of thought and feeling; when they betray no sense Of a larger audience than the friends for whom alone they were written. The contents Of these volumes do not uniformly maintain so high an excellence, but they exhibit many striking examples Of it. Letters which are known to have been intended for publication.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from A Letter to an American Friend At the moment of writing we have reached the gravest crisis of the world-war. Russia lies prostrate at the feet of the common enemy; the Ukraine has not only made peace but is preparing to receive aid in her struggle against the Bolshevik Government; Roumania is isolated and helpless in presence of the convulsions of her once mighty neighbour, and may be compelled to get the best terms she can from the conqueror, as the Entente Powers are through force of circumstances unable to render her any immediately effective assistance; Poland, Courland, Lithuania, Finland - all are at the disposal of their German military masters. Plainly, for the time being at any rate, Eastern Europe has been swept within the orbit of German military domination, with all that that portentous fact implies.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Letter and Social Aims The perception of matter is made the common-sense, and for cause. This was the cradle, this the go-cart, of the human child. We must learn the homely laws of fire and water; we must feed, wash, plant, build. These are ends of necessity, and first in the order of beadles and guardsmen that hold us to common-sense. The intellect yielded up to itself, cannot supersede this tyrannic necessity. The restraining grace of common-sense is the mark of all the valid minds, - of AEsop, Aristotle, Alfred, Luther, Shakspeare, Cervantes, Franklin, Napoleon. The common-sense which does not meddle with the absolute, but takes things at their word, - things as they appear, - believes in the existence of matter, not because we can touch it, or conceive of it, but because it agrees with ourselves, and the universe does not jest with us, but is in earnest, - is the house of health and life. In spite of all the joys of poets and the joys of saints, the most imaginative and abstracted person never makes, with impunity, the least mistake in this particular, - never tries to kindle his over with water, nor carries by the tail.
